Antibodies Are A Part Of Which Type Of Immunity. Immunity to a disease is achieved through the presence of antibodies to that disease in a person's system. Antibodies (immunoglobulins) are proteins that are produced by white blood cells called b cells and that tightly bind to the antigen of an invader, tagging the invader for attack or directly. Terms in this set (16) which part of the adaptive immune response involves b cells? Antibodies are a part of which type of immunity? Antibodies are the functional basis of humoral immunity. An antibody, also known as an immunoglobulin (ig), is a protein that is produced by plasma cells after stimulation by an antigen.
